Mark Levy,
Jewish Folksongs in Yiddish, Hebrew and Ladino

We close out this season with a bang (in three languages!) Courtesy of the Hirschhorn Foundation and the JCC, Mark Levy brings us a delightful evening of Jewish folksongs, the Language of the Soul.  Mark delivers a song with such feeling and conviction that audiences around the world are mesmerized. Descended from an Eastern European Ashkenazi mother and a Western European Sephardi father, he combines the beautiful Yiddish and Ladino melodies of both traditions with the newer Hebrew and Israeli songs in a versatile performance that constantly transports the listener to another time and place.

Join BK Reads and travel back to postwar Brooklyn as we discuss Pete Hamill's Snow in August, a New York Time's bestseller. Michael Delvin, an 11-year-old altar boy, befriends Rabbi Judah Hirsch, a Holocaust survivor from Czechoslovakia. The two form a strong bond in which they help and learn from one another, as well as fight anainst neighborhood prejudice.
